Now, I mentioned yesterday that this is kind of a changing industry.

0:56.0

And I said something like, you know, if your industry is changing, you can choose to resist that and fight against it.

1:02.0

Or you can choose to adapt. Even if it's not your preference, even if you say, you know what?

1:06.0

I liked it the way it was before, but it's not all about me.

1:09.0

If I'm going to offer something for sale, I have to understand what people want.

1:12.0

And even though change is hard sometimes, I really do think it's going to be much easier.

1:16.0

At least for most people in most industries, to pay attention to what's going on

1:20.0

and understand that they can't do things the same way all the time.

1:23.0

Now, I know this can sometimes be personal for people.

1:26.0

If you're a web designer, you might very well say, I'm only going to take clients with good budgets.

1:31.0

I'm just not going to worry about that trend of low-cost design.

1:34.0

Now, in this case, there are still people and companies who have more budget for design.
